I found this on the rift forum, thought it was a nice (none benchmark) way of locating your bottleneck, if the game runs badly:

You can tell which part is holding you back, your Video Card or your CPU/Motherboard by running the test below.

Put all your settings on LOW and check your FPS.
Put all your settings on MAX and check your FPS.

If your FPS on Low is BETTER then your FPS on Max, Then you need to Upgrade your Video Card.
If your FPS on Low is ABOUT THE SAME as your FPS on Max, Then your Cpu/Motherboard is bottlenecked and you need better.
